I know from experience that your dentist should prescribe the antibiotics. I once had what I thought was a toothache and a general gum infection. My GP prescribed antibiotics, but they were not correct for my condition, which turned out to be Gingivitis, and I need a longer course of different antibiotics, which meant I spent just as much money on prescriptions, as I would have, had I seen my dentist and paid for a proper consultation. I would not risk doing this agian. Your dentist knows best.
